On Fri, Mar 26, 2021 at 01:20:33AM -0400, Julian Braha wrote:
> When SB1XXX_CORELIS is enabled, COMPILE_TEST is disabled,
> and DEBUG_KERNEL is disabled, Kbuild gives the
> following warning:
> 
> WARNING: unmet direct dependencies detected for DEBUG_INFO
>   Depends on [n]: DEBUG_KERNEL [=n] && !COMPILE_TEST [=n]
>   Selected by [y]:
>   - SB1XXX_CORELIS [=y] && SIBYTE_SB1xxx_SOC [=y] && !COMPILE_TEST [=n]
> 
> This is because SB1XXX_CORELIS selects DEBUG_INFO without
> selecting or depending on DEBUG_KERNEL, despite DEBUG_INFO
> depending on DEBUG_KERNEL.
